Q&A

  • ADOConnection에 대해 알려주십시요.
데이터베이스를 연결할때 ADOConnection을 사용하고, 그 결과값을 ADODataset에 담아서 보려고 합니다.

그런데 해당되는 값이 하나도 나오지 않아서 이렇게 질문을 드립니다.

고수님들의 많은 조언 부탁드립니다.

일단 폼 생성시에

    DBCon.ConnectionString := '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:PAM.mdb;Mode=ReadWrite;Persist Security Info=False';
    DBCon.Open;

이렇게 했습니다. DBCon은 TADOConnection 이구요.

그다음 로그인 버튼을 눌렀을 때

    ADOSet.Connection := DBCon;
    ADOSet.CommandText := 'SELECT * FROM TB_EMPLOYEE';
    ADOSet.Active := TRUE;
    ADOSet.Open;
    ADOSet.First;
    strID := ADOSet.Fields[1].Value;

위와 같이 했습니다. ADOSet은  TADODataset 입니다.

그런데 데이터베이스에는 값이 들어있는데 strID의 값이 안 나옵니다.

왜 그런지 알려주시면 감사하겠습니다.
0  COMMENTS